Football: After moving to Saudi Arabia, Cristiano Ronaldo became the highest-paid athlete on Forbes’ list in 2023.

Cristiano Ronaldo, who signed a contract with the Saudi soccer club through 2025 after leaving Manchester United last year, earned $136 million. Forbes estimates that his annual playing salary increased to $75 million.

The media have estimated that Ronaldo’s contract is worth more than 219,98 million euros.After earning a total of $130 million, PSG forward Messi, who is 35 years old, came in second, followed by club teammate and France captain Mbappe, who is 24 years old and earned $120 million to rank third.Qatar Sports Investments owns PSG.

LeBron James, a star NBA player and member of the Los Angeles Lakers, earned $119,5 million, and Canelo Alvarez, a Mexican boxer, earned $110 million.
